What Is A Consequent Boundary In Human Geography Consequent boundaries are drawn in order to separate groups based on ethnic, linguistic, religious, or economic differences. as mentioned in section 13.4, boundaries can influence the solidarity of a state, as boundaries disputes can result in conflict. sometimes, consequent boundaries involve the movement of people, either voluntarily or forced. consequent boundaries can help reduce ethnic conflicts by aligning political borders with cultural identities, promoting stability.
